Aminophenazone
go.drugbank.com/drugs/DB01424ApprovedWithdrawnAminophenazone is a pyrazolone with analgesic, anti-inflammatory, and antipyretic properties that carries a risk of agranulocytosis. … The FDA suspended the use of aminophenazone due to its association with agranulocytosis, a life-threatening side effect.[A254242,L43942]
Lincomycin
go.drugbank.com/drugs/DB01627ApprovedInvestigationalVet approved[A190657, A190621] Lincomycin was approved by the FDA on December 29, 1964.[L33214] … Lincomycin is a lincosamide antibiotic first isolated from the soil bacterium _Streptomyces lincolnensis_ in Lincoln, Nebraska.

Ribociclib
go.drugbank.com/drugs/DB11730ApprovedInvestigationalRibociclib is a selective cyclin-dependent kinase inhibitor, a class of drugs that help slow the progression of cancer by inhibiting two proteins called cyclin-dependent kinase 4 and 6 (CDK4/6). … Ribociclib was approved by the FDA in March 2017 under the brand name Kisqali.

Zanidatamab
go.drugbank.com/drugs/DB15471ApprovedInvestigationalZanidatamab is a bispecific antibody that binds two non-overlapping sites of HER2 (ERBB2). … [A264718] In November 2024, the FDA granted an accelerated approval for zanidatamab for use in previously treated unresectable or metastatic HER2-positive biliary tract cancers.[L51908,L51903]
